Obituary of Helen Dasko DASKO, Helen (Nee Yascheshyn) On Friday, June 8, 2018, in Peterborough, Ontario, Helen Dasko passed away at the age of 90. She was born October 10, 1927 in Melrose, Manitoba. Helen is survived by her loving husband William (Bill), daughters Donna and Tricia (Howard), grandchildren Marion & William Dasko Adams, sister Violet Kerde of Winnipeg, and many nieces and nephews. She was predeceased by her parents Regina (Agnes) and John Yascheshyn, brothers Frank, Casey & Johnny Yascheshyn and sisters Jean Sawicki, Kay Kazina and Emily Jackson. Many thanks to Dr. A. Silverberg and the staff at St. Joseph at Fleming Long Term Care for their kindness and care during Helen's last years. As one of Jehovah's Witnesses for almost 50 years, she enjoyed sharing with others the Bible's promise that God's Kingdom will soon bring peaceful and paradise conditions to the earth, when God will 'wipe out every tear from their eyes and death will be no more, neither will mourning, nor outcry, nor pain be anymore. The former things have passed away'. Rev 21:4 Cremation has taken place.
